Hey all,
I purchased an IR Blaster from irblaster.info which I cannot seem to get working.
I've disabled kernel support for ttyS0.
I'm running lircd with the following command:
/usr/sbin/lircd --driver=default --device=/dev/lirc3 --output=/dev/lircd1
and then I execute:
irsend -d /dev/lircd1 SEND_ONCE DCT700 power
The command completes without any errors, however, the cable box doesn't turn off and I can't see the blaster's led flash in a webcam.
Dmesg gives me:
Interrupt 4, port 03f8 obtained
lirc_serial: SET_SEND_CARRIER
lirc_serial: in init_timing_params, freq=38000, duty_cycle=50, clk/jiffy=2999898, pulse=39472, space=39472, conv_us_to_clocks=2999
lirc_serial: SET_SEND_DUTY_CYCLE
lirc_serial: in init_timing_params, freq=38000, duty_cycle=50, clk/jiffy=2999898, pulse=39472, space=39472, conv_us_to_clocks=2999
lirc_serial: freed IRQ 4
So it looks like it's doing something, I'm just not sure what.
Any help would be greatly appreciated.
